> Connector and Resource configuration versioning
> -----------------------------------------------
>
> Key: SYNCOPE-1145
> UR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/SYNCOPE-1145
> Project: Syncope
> Issue Type: New Feature
> Components: common, console, core
> Reporter: Francesco Chicchiriccò
> Assignee: Francesco Chicchiriccò
> Fix For: 2.0.5, 2.1.0
>
>
> It often happens that, while playing with Connectors' and Resources'
> configuration, everything works up until a certain point, then some
> misconfiguration happens and errors start appearing.
> In such situations, it would be handy to have a simple mechanism to revert to
> a previous (working) situation.
